数据库学习指南涵盖了Mysql、MongoDB、PostgreSQL等常见数据库的操作指南和实践手册,帮助读者全面掌握数据库管理和优化技能。
数据库学习指南的全面介绍
相关推荐
Access数据库全面学习指南
《ACCESS数据库学习教程》是一份全面且详尽的资源,专为那些想要深入了解或自学ACCESS数据库管理系统的初学者设计。ACCESS是微软公司开发的一款关系型数据库管理系统,以其易用性和强大的功能在个人和小型企业中广泛应用。本教程将带你一步步走进ACCESS的世界,通过深入学习,你可以掌握创建、管理和维护数据库的基础知识以及高级技巧。
教程将介绍ACCESS的基本概念,包括数据库、表、字段、记录和索引等核心元素。数据库是存储数据的集合,而表则是构成数据库的基本单位,由一系列字段组成,每个字段存储特定类型的数据。记录是表中的每一行,索引则用于提高查询速度。
接着,你会学习如何创建和设计数据库。这包括规划数据库结构,定义字段类型、大小、格式和验证规则,以及设置主键以确保数据的唯一性。同时,了解如何使用查询来检索、筛选、排序和组合数据,这是数据库管理中的重要技能。在教程中,你将接触SQL(Structured Query Language),这是访问和操作数据库的标准语言。
接下来,你会学习到表间关系的概念,包括一对一、一对多和多对多关系。理解这些关系对于建立数据间的关联至关重要,可以有效地防止数据冗余和不一致性。同时,你还将学会使用表间的链接,以便在不同表之间进行数据操作。
报表和窗体是ACCESS的重要组成部分,它们提供了用户友好的界面来展示和操作数据。教程会教你如何设计和自定义这些对象,包括添加控件、设置格式和应用计算。同时,你还能学习到宏和模块,它们允许你编写自动化任务和自定义函数,提升数据库的效率。
此外,教程还会涉及数据导入导出,使你能够将数据与Excel、CSV或其他数据库系统无缝连接。这在数据迁移和整合过程中非常实用。你将了解到数据库的安全和管理,包括用户权限设置、备份和恢复策略,以确保数据库的稳定性和数据的安全。
《ACCESS数据库学习教程》覆盖了从基础到进阶的所有关键知识点,无论你是完全的初学者还是有一定经验的学习者,都能从中受益。通过这个教程,你将具备使用ACCESS设计和管理高效数据库的能力,为日常工作和项目带来便利。在学习过程中,不断实践和探索,将理论与实际相结合,你的数据库管理技能将会显著提升。
Access
0
2024-11-03
MATLAB的全面学习指南
MATLAB是一种强大的数学软件,广泛应用于科学计算和工程领域。它提供了丰富的功能,包括开发算法与应用程序、数据可视化、数值分析等。本书详细介绍了MATLAB的安装与启动、基本表达式命令、矩阵和数组操作、数据类型、数值计算、符号计算、编程基础、数据可视化、图像处理、GUI设计等内容。适合初学者和专业人士学习和参考。
Matlab
3
2024-07-16
SQL学习指南的全面解析
《SQL学习指南(第二版)》是专为SQL初学者和进阶者设计的教程,详细覆盖了SQL语言的基础知识至高级应用。SQL,即结构化查询语言,是管理和处理关系数据库的标准编程语言。本书通过深入浅出的方式解释SQL的核心概念,帮助读者掌握这一强大的数据操作工具。内容包括SQL基础、查询技巧、高级应用、窗口函数、事务与并发控制、数据库设计与优化以及实战案例。
MySQL
0
2024-09-26
Oracle错误的全面学习指南
学习Oracle的必备工具,深入了解Oracle错误,掌握解决方案,助您顺利应对数据库挑战。
Oracle
0
2024-09-30
Oracle教程数据库系统全面学习指南
Oracle教程PPT和视频是学习和掌握Oracle数据库系统的重要资源,特别适合初学者以及需要深入理解数据库管理的软件开发者。Oracle数据库是全球广泛使用的大型关系型数据库管理系统,提供了高效、安全的数据存储和管理功能。在Oracle教程PPT中,通常会涵盖以下几个核心知识点:
1. Oracle数据库基础
介绍Oracle的历史、版本以及其在企业级应用中的地位。讲解数据库的基本概念,如数据模型(关系型数据模型)、表空间、段、区、块等。
2. 安装与配置
如何在不同的操作系统环境下安装Oracle数据库服务器,包括配置环境变量、创建监听器、设置初始化参数文件等步骤。
3. SQL语言
详细讲解SQL语言在Oracle中的应用,包括DML(增、删、改、查)操作,DDL(定义数据结构)如创建表、索引,以及PL/SQL编程基础。
4. 数据库对象
深入理解表、视图、索引、存储过程、触发器、游标等数据库对象的创建和管理。
5. 安全性
用户权限管理,角色的创建和赋权,以及如何通过SQL*Plus进行安全管理。
6. 备份与恢复
Oracle的数据保护策略,如RMAN(恢复管理器)的使用,数据泵导出导入,逻辑备份等。
7. 性能优化
解释SQL查询优化器的工作原理,如何通过Explain Plan分析查询执行计划,以及调整索引、表分区等提升数据库性能的方法。
8. 数据库架构
Oracle数据库的体系结构,包括实例和数据库的区别,SGA(系统全局区域)组件的组成。
9. 高可用性与集群
Oracle RAC(Real Application Clusters)技术,以及数据守护等高可用解决方案。
10. 数据库管理
数据库的日常维护,如空间管理、表空间扩展、归档日志模式等。
视频教程则提供更加直观和动态的学习体验,通过实际操作演示帮助学习者更好地理解和掌握这些概念,包括演示安装过程、创建数据库、执行SQL语句、管理数据库对象、解决常见问题等实战场景。Oracle教程PPT和视频结合使用,能够形成理论与实践的互补,使学习者更全面地掌握Oracle数据库的使用和管理,为在软件开发中有效利用Oracle数据库打下坚实基础。
Oracle
0
2024-11-06
全面的Oracle学习指南
这是一份详尽的Oracle学习教程,涵盖了Oracle数据库的各个方面。
Oracle
0
2024-08-15
SQL Server 2005数据库全面学习指南电子教材
SQL Server 2005是微软公司发布的一款强大的关系型数据库管理系统,作为SQL Server系列的重要版本,提供了广泛的企业级数据管理和分析功能。本教材的目标是帮助初学者全面理解和掌握SQL Server 2005的基础知识,包括数据库设计、管理、开发和优化技能。在技术进步的推动下,SQL Server 2005已经成为许多企业不可或缺的工具,它的管理和开发都通过企业管理器(SQL Server Management Studio, SSMS)进行,SSMS提供了直观的图形界面和强大的脚本编写功能。数据库设计阶段涵盖了实体关系模型(ER模型)、数据正常化以及索引和视图的使用,这些步骤和工具都是数据库管理员和开发者不可或缺的一部分。此外,SQL Server 2005还支持存储过程和触发器的使用,这些功能提高了数据库的安全性和效率。安全性方面,SQL Server 2005提供了灵活的角色和权限管理,确保了数据的安全性和完整性。
MySQL
0
2024-08-13
从新手到专业PostgreSQL数据库全面学习指南
本书详细介绍了PostgreSQL数据库的基础概念和高级特性,涵盖了SQL语言的基本操作、数据管理、性能调优以及高可用性配置。虽然基于较旧的PostgreSQL 9.x版本,但其内容仍然具有实用价值,特别适合初学者和有经验的开发者。读者将学会如何创建和管理数据库、执行复杂查询以及优化数据库性能。
PostgreSQL
0
2024-10-15
数据库学习指南
帮助初学者快速掌握数据库基础知识的学习资源
Oracle
1
2024-07-29